A Handy plumber tightening a pipe joint with a wrench

Plumbing & drainage

Leaks, pressure, blocked runs and full bathroom pipework, by licensed plumbers.

24-hour callout

Leak detection

Every plumber on the crew is licensed and works to the Ghana Standards Authority code for potable water. We carry pressure gauges and acoustic leak detection, so a wet patch on a ceiling gets traced rather than guessed at — which is usually the difference between replacing a metre of pipe and replacing a floor.

Two Handy decorators rolling a first coat onto an interior wall

Painting & decorating

Preparation first. Two coats, cut in by hand, and the furniture back where it was.

Low-odour paints

Evening work

Most of a good paint job is what happens before the tin is opened: filling, sanding, masking and a proper primer coat. We quote for preparation as a line of its own so you can see it, we cut in edges by hand rather than taping everything, and we will work evenings and weekends where a room cannot be out of use during the day.

A Handy joiner sanding a timber panel in the workshop

Carpentry & joinery

Wardrobes, kitchens, doors and staircases, made to the measurements of your room.

Made to measure

Kiln-dried timber

Fitted wardrobes, kitchen carcasses, internal doors, decking and repairs to what is already there. We build in our own workshop in Tema from kiln-dried timber rather than assembling flat-pack on site, which is why our units still shut properly after a harmattan and a rainy season.

How it works

What happens after you ring

No surveyor's fee, no obligation, and no work started before you have seen a number.

01

You call or write

Tell us what needs doing. Small jobs are booked on the spot; anything bigger gets a visit, usually within two working days.

02

We come and look

A supervisor sees the job in person and quotes it in writing the same day — itemised, with preparation costed separately from the finish.

03

You pick a date

You get a date, a two-hour arrival window and the name of the person coming. Half up front on anything over GHS 5,000; nothing before that.

04

We finish and tidy

Photographs of the finished work, waste taken away, certificates emailed the same day, and twelve months on the workmanship.

Asked often

Before you book

How quickly can somebody come out?

Most non-urgent jobs are offered a slot within three working days, and we hold a small number of same-day slots back for emergencies. Burst pipes and dead boards are a twenty-four-hour callout on a separate number; nothing else is charged at an emergency rate.

Do I need to be there while you work?

No, as long as we can get in and out. Plenty of our customers leave a key with a neighbour or the estate office. You get a message when the van leaves the depot, photographs of the finished work, and a call if we find anything you would want to know about.

What happens if something goes wrong afterwards?

Our workmanship carries twelve months, and roofing carries five years. If something we did fails inside that, we come back and put it right at no charge — no argument about whether it was the fitting or the fitter. Manufacturer warranties on parts run alongside that, and we register them for you.
